Sans Normal Unnoj 15 is a very light, normal width, high cont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

This typeface uses an extremely delicate stroke with pronounced contrast between thick verticals and hairline joins. Forms are largely built from clean circular and elliptical geometry, with smooth curves and sharply tapered terminals that stay crisp rather than calligraphic. Proportions feel open and generously spaced, with tall ascenders and a calm, vertical rhythm; round letters like O and Q read as near-perfect bowls, while diagonals in V/W/X are thin and precise. The lowercase mixes compact, simple constructions with occasional long, fine strokes (notably in f, j, and y), giving the text a light, shimmering texture at display sizes.

It is best suited to editorial display work such as magazine headlines, fashion and beauty branding, luxury packaging, and large-format posters where its hairline contrast and open shapes can remain crisp. It can also work for short pull quotes or titling in refined layouts, especially when paired with generous spacing and high-quality output.

Overall, the font conveys sophistication and restraint, balancing modern clarity with a fashion-like delicacy. The high-contrast thinness creates a luxurious, high-end tone that feels composed and quiet rather than expressive or playful.

The design appears intended to deliver a sleek, contemporary display voice with a premium feel, using geometric roundness and extreme stroke contrast to create a polished, high-impact silhouette while keeping the overall look minimal and controlled.

In paragraph samples the hairlines contribute to a bright page color and a refined cadence, but the finest strokes and small details (such as dots and thin diagonals) become visually subtle as size decreases. Numerals follow the same contrast-driven approach, with slender figures and generous interior space that aligns well with the overall airy construction.
